大数据的特点主要包括哪些?
500
2024-04-26
在当今数字化时代,大数据已经成为各行业发展的重要驱动力。而要充分利用大数据的潜力,日志收集是至关重要的一环。大数据日志收集不仅能够帮助企业实时监控和分析系统运行情况,还能为业务决策提供关键的数据支持。
大数据日志收集是指将系统运行过程中产生的各类日志信息进行采集、存储和分析的过程。这些日志信息包含了系统运行的各种指标、异常情况和用户行为等重要数据,对于系统性能优化、故障排查和安全监控都至关重要。
通过实时收集和分析大数据日志,企业可以了解系统的运行状况、用户行为趋势以及潜在的风险因素,及时做出相应的调整和决策,从而提升业务的效率和竞争力。
实现高效的大数据日志收集需要依托于一些关键技术,包括但不限于:
大数据日志收集具有广泛的应用场景,涵盖了各个行业和领域。一些常见的应用包括:
通过对大数据日志收集的重要性、关键技术和应用场景的深入探讨,我们可以看到其在数字化转型和业务发展中的不可替代性。只有充分利用大数据日志收集的价值,企业才能更好地把握市场动态,优化运营流程,实现可持续发展。
大数据日志收集,让数据驱动业务,助力企业发展!
随着科技的不断发展,大数据在各个领域的应用越来越广泛。大数据是指规模巨大、生命周期长、格式多样的数据资源,对于企业决策、市场分析、用户行为预测等方面具有重要意义。
大数据分析需要从各个渠道收集数据,其中日志收集是不可或缺的一环。日志作为记录系统运行状态、用户操作等重要信息的载体,对于系统稳定性、故障排查和安全性具有关键作用。
日志收集是指通过自动化工具将系统产生的日志信息进行收集、存储、分析,并生成报告的过程。日志收集不仅有助于监控系统运行状态,还可以帮助企业了解用户行为、优化产品功能,提升用户体验。
大数据时代对于日志收集提出了更高的要求,需要对海量的日志数据进行快速高效的处理,以获取有价值的信息。日志收集工具的选择和配置,直接影响到后续数据分析的效果。
在大数据环境下,常用的日志收集工具有多种,包括但不限于:
在配置日志收集工具时,需要考虑以下几个方面:
通过合理的日志收集配置,可以更好地利用大数据技术,为企业决策和业务发展提供有力支持。
尽管日志收集对于大数据分析至关重要,但在实际应用中也面临一些挑战:
面对这些挑战,企业需要更加注重日志收集工作的规范化和自动化,提升数据处理效率和质量。
在大数据时代,日志收集是数据分析的基础,对于企业决策和业务优化具有重要意义。通过合理选择和配置日志收集工具,可以更好地利用数据资源,提升企业的竞争力和商业价值。
fluent是不同于原有的日志规则的收集,是一种筛选性质的收集方式,可以从头到尾反复收集。
一款新的 Docker 日志收集工具:log-pilot。log-pilot 是我们为您提供的日志收集镜像。
可以在每台机器上部署一个 log-pilot 实例,就可以收集机器上所有 Docker 应用日志。
log-pilot 具有如下特性:一个单独的 log 进程收集机器上所有容器的日志。不需要为每个容器启动一个 log 进程。
支持文件日志和 stdout。docker log dirver 亦或 logspout 只能处理 stdout,log-pilot 不仅支持收集 stdout 日志,还可以收集文件志。
声明式配置。当您的容器有日志要收集,只要通过 label 声明要收集的日志文件的路径,无需改动其他任何配置,log-pilot 就会自动收集新容器的日志。
支持多种日志存储方式。无论是强大的阿里云日志服务,还是比较流行的 elasticsearch 组合,甚至是 graylog,log-pilot 都能把日志投递到正确的地点。
开源。log-pilot 完全开源,可以从 Git项目地址 下载代码。
命令为var/log/message 。
记录系统重要信息的日志,记录Linux系统的绝大多数重要信息,如果系统出现问题,首先要检查的就是应该是这个日志文件;
/var/log/secure 记录验证和授权方面的信息,只要涉及账户和密码的程序都会记录。比如说系统的登录,ssh的登录,su切换用户,sudo授权,甚至添加用户和修改用户密码;
/var/log/wtmp 永久记录所有用户的登录、注销信息,同时记录系统的启动、重启、关机事件。同样这个文件也是一个二进制文件不能直接vi而需要使用last命令来查看;
/var/run/utmp 记录当前已经登录的用户的信息。这个文件会随着用户的登录和注销而不断变化,只记录当前登录用户的信息,同样这个文件不能直接vi,要使用w,who,users等命令;
日志收集分析系统是现代企业不可或缺的一部分,它可以帮助企业更好地了解其系统的运行情况,及时发现潜在的问题,并采取相应的措施来减少风险和降低成本。随着企业规模的扩大和系统的复杂性的增加,日志收集分析系统的需求也日益增长。
日志收集分析系统的主要功能包括:
在选择日志收集分析系统时,企业需要考虑系统的可靠性、稳定性、易用性和成本等因素。同时,企业还需要考虑系统的安全性和隐私保护,确保数据的安全和合规性。
日志收集分析系统广泛应用于各种行业和场景,例如:
总之,日志收集分析系统是企业数字化转型的重要工具之一,能够帮助企业更好地了解其系统的运行情况,提高系统的可靠性和稳定性,降低成本和风险。>
在开发 Android 应用程序时,日志收集是调试和疑难解答过程中的关键步骤。通过记录应用程序的运行时信息和错误,开发人员可以更轻松地追踪问题并进行修复。因此,有效的 Android app 日志收集系统对于保持应用程序的稳定性和性能至关重要。
Android 应用程序通常在各种设备和操作系统版本上运行,这可能导致不同的问题和 bug。通过实现日志收集功能,开发人员可以:
要实现有效的日志收集系统,开发人员可以考虑以下关键因素:
Android 提供了不同的日志级别,如 verbose、debug、info、warn 和 error。开发人员应根据需要选择适当的级别,并确保记录足够的信息以便调试。
选择适合应用程序需求的日志库非常重要。一些流行的 Android 日志库包括 Logcat、Timber 和 SLF4J。这些库提供了不同的功能和配置选项,开发人员可以根据实际情况进行选择。
除了基本的日志信息外,开发人员还应该添加关键信息,如时间戳、线程信息、设备型号等。这些信息有助于跟踪和定位问题,并提供更全面的上下文。
开发人员应谨慎处理日志输出,避免在发布版本中记录敏感信息。可以使用混淆或条件编译等技术来控制日志输出内容。
为了更好地监控应用程序的运行状态,开发人员可以考虑实现远程日志收集功能。通过将日志上传到服务器或第三方工具,开发人员可以实时查看应用程序的运行状况,并快速响应问题。
Android app 日志收集是开发过程中不可或缺的一环。通过合理设置日志级别、选择适当的日志库、添加关键信息以及实现远程日志收集,开发人员可以更轻松地调试和监控应用程序,提升用户体验和应用稳定性。
在进行日志收集时,确定要收集哪些字段是非常重要的。日志是系统运行过程中产生的记录,包含了大量有价值的信息,在故障排查、性能优化以及安全监控中扮演着至关重要的角色。因此,确定合适的日志字段,可以帮助我们更好地理解系统运行情况,快速定位问题,并作出相应的优化措施。
常规字段
首先,我们来看一下日志收集中常见的字段,这些字段通常包括:
这些字段通常被认为是日志中必不可少的基本信息,通过它们可以迅速了解事件发生的时间、地点以及内容,是日志分析的基础。
业务字段
除了常规字段外,针对不同系统或应用的特点,我们还需要收集一些业务相关的字段,以便更好地了解系统运行状态和用户行为。这些字段可以根据具体业务需求定制,一般包括:
这些业务字段可以帮助我们深入了解用户在系统中的操作行为,及时监控业务处理状态,发现潜在问题并进行及时处理,提升系统的稳定性和用户体验。
性能字段
在一些对性能要求较高的系统中,还需要收集一些性能相关的字段,以便及时发现并解决系统性能瓶颈,提升系统运行效率。这些字段主要包括:
通过监控这些性能字段,可以及时发现系统性能问题,从而进行调优和优化,提高系统的稳定性和吞吐能力。
安全字段
最后,对于安全要求较高的系统,还需要收集一些安全相关的字段,以便监控系统的安全状态,及时发现并应对潜在的安全威胁。这些字段主要包括:
通过监控这些安全字段,可以更好地保护系统的安全性,预防潜在攻击,确保系统数据和用户信息的安全。
综合分析
综上所述,日志收集中要收集哪些字段,需要根据具体业务场景和需求来确定。合理选择并收集这些字段,可以帮助我们更好地监控系统运行状况,及时发现和解决问题,提升系统的稳定性、性能和安全性。因此,在进行日志收集设计时,务必充分考虑到系统特点和需求,合理确定需要收集的字段,以实现更加高效可靠的日志管理和分析。
日志收集与分析是现代IT系统中至关重要的一环。随着大数据时代的到来,企业需要处理越来越多的日志数据,以从中提取有价值的信息,改善系统的性能和安全性。在这种背景下,日志收集与分析系统成为了不可或缺的工具。
日志收集与分析系统是一种集中化的解决方案,用于自动收集和存储系统和应用程序生成的日志数据。它使得企业可以方便地管理和查询大量的日志数据,并通过分析这些日志数据来获得有关系统运行状况和业务活动的深入洞察。
日志是IT系统中的重要组成部分,记录了系统的各种活动、错误和警告。通过对这些日志进行收集和分析,企业可以实现以下目标:
一个强大的日志收集与分析系统应具备以下关键功能:
市场上有许多成熟的日志收集与分析系统可供选择。下面是一些常见的系统:
选择适合的日志收集与分析系统需要考虑以下几个因素:
综上所述,日志收集与分析系统在现代企业中扮演着重要角色,可帮助企业实现故障排除、性能优化、安全监控和业务分析等目标。选择适合的系统对于提高企业的效率和竞争力至关重要。因此,在引入日志收集与分析系统时,企业应该全面考虑自身需求,并选择适合的系统。